DAMAGE


Meaning of DAMAGE in English

I. noun Etymology: Middle English, from Anglo-French, from dan ~, from Latin damnum Date: 14th century loss or harm resulting from injury to person, property, or reputation, compensation in money imposed by law for loss or injury, expense , cost , II. transitive verb (~d; damaging) Date: 14th century to cause ~ to , see: injure ~ability noun ~r noun
